Windows 11 represents the pinnacle of "Fluent Design," characterized by translucent materials (Mica), rounded corners, and minimalism. In this environment, the chaotic, 8-bit aesthetic of After Dark serves as a "digital vintage" counterpoint.

Beyond aesthetics, the "After Dark" movement in Windows 11 speaks to a physiological need. We are a species bathed in blue light. The standard Windows interface, while efficient, is designed to keep us alert. Switching to a dark, ambient screensaver is a signal to the brain: the work is done, or the work is slow. after dark screensaver windows 11

Modern developers have created spiritual successors to these classics for Windows 11, updating them for 4K and 8K resolutions. There is a profound irony in running a simulation of a flying toaster on a machine capable of rendering complex 3D environments. Yet, doing so acts as a rebellion against the sleek, minimalist perfection of modern UI design. It reminds the user that the computer is a playground as much as it is a workspace. The resurgence of interest in screensavers on Windows 11 is partly driven by the rise of "cozy computing." As our work and home lives have merged, users have begun decorating their desktops with the same care they apply to their living rooms. An active screensaver—whether it is a slow-panning landscape, a geometric fluid simulation, or a virtual rain-slicked city street—serves as a digital fireplace.
